Are Arsenal on the verge of becoming "The Untouchables"? In this episode, John Cross, Chief Football Writer for the Daily Mirror, breaks down Arsenal's monumental achievement of capturing the Premier League title after a 22-year drought. Reflecting on the incredible transformation under Mikel Arteta since December 2019, John dives into how the Gunners cured the toxicity, rebuilt their culture, and finally outgunned Pep Guardiola's Manchester City juggernaut. We discuss how Arsenal shook off the "bottler" allegations after devastating defeats, their shift to a pragmatic but resilient mentality, and the massive performances from stars like Declan Rice, David Raya, William Saliba, and Bukayo Saka.
